- Ms. Harris' GT ELA/Math: In math this week we will be working on multiplying multi digit numbers. Students will start with 4x1 digit and build to 2x2 digits. They will be learning the standard algorithm that most adults use, as well as the area model which helps them multiply using place value. Unless otherwise stated, students can use the method that they feel most comfortable using. In reading we will be finishing our novel, "The Westing Game."
